Portugal

Property prices in Portugal are on the rise from the In third quarter of 2019, property prices in Portugal increased by 7.92% year-on-year. According to the report of international Finance Magazine, they said that seven years after the introduction of the Golden Visa program, Portugal has become the most popular property market in the euro zone, surpassing Spain. House prices are still relatively low compared to other European cities such as Paris, London, Amsterdam and Madrid. Rental yields in Lisbon are 4.5% – 6.7 incredibly high the growth of tourism and rental platforms such as Airbnb, the short-term rental market has become increasingly popular with investors, allowing owners to enjoy higher rental yields and increased flexibility.

Spain

While property prices in some of Spain’s major cities have fallen this year, overall house prices rose by 5.3% in June 2019. Madrid and Barcelona have always been top investment destinations for investors, but Malaga and Valencia have also become very popular in the last three years. Rental returns in Barcelona offer an average annual return of 5%. In 2019, 11 years after the financial crisis, property prices in Spain are still below their peak, meaning there is still plenty of room for capital growth.
